To solve for \( x \) in the equation
\[
\frac{x}{12} = \frac{3}{2},
\]
you can start by multiplying both sides of the equation by 12 to eliminate the fraction. This gives you:
\[
x = 12 \cdot \frac{3}{2}.
\]
Now, calculate \( 12 \cdot \frac{3}{2} \):
\[
x = 12 \cdot \frac{3}{2} = \frac{12 \cdot 3}{2} = \frac{36}{2} = 18.
\]
Thus, the solution is
\[
\boxed{18}.
\]
